Received my Sunbeam Tiger boot yesterday and it is far, far better than the one that came with my car - 100% improvement. It's not nearly as stiff. I went ahead and installed it to try it out. I still get a little pull back on the stick when I place it in 3rd but not as much as with the stock boot. With the vinyl boot I don't get any pull back. I took it for a short test drive and didn't have any problems with staying in 3rd gear - but it didn't kick out very often so I don't know that this is complete vindication. I think I will stick with it until I have an instance of kicking out of 3rd and if I do, then I will reinstall the sewn vinyl boot.
